The Age of Shadows dives into this tense, shadowy world of espionage in the late 1920s. You can feel the weight of history in every frame, especially with how it captures the desperation of the resistance fighters. The pacing is brisk, threading through the cat-and-mouse dynamics effectively, keeping you on edge. There's a gritty realism in the practical effects, which adds to the authenticity of the action sequences. The performances are strong, with the leads portraying a complex web of loyalty and betrayal. It’s not just about the action; it’s steeped in themes of sacrifice and national identity that resonate even today. The cinematography, too, has an atmospheric quality that enhances the tension throughout.
